Background
Food processing, which refers to grain grinding, feed processing, vegetable oil and sugar processing, slaughtering, meat processing, aquatic product processing and food processing activities of vegetables, fruits, nuts and the like which are directly carried out by taking agricultural, forestry, animal husbandry and fishery products as raw materials, and is a type of generalized agricultural product processing industry;
in the mode of food processing, also be a very important branch to the filling of liquid, food processing realizes automated production step by step at present, and present filling device, it is single to pour into the drink taste, and filling inefficiency can not mix the canning to often easily neglect the dress or fill and spill, influence the sanitary condition of filling, the washing of filling is also very inconvenient moreover, consumes very big manpower to go to find the effect after the washing and not obtain effectual improvement.

The working principle is as follows: the reaction barrel 1 is divided into four liquid storage tanks 15 by the two partition boards 2, different liquid raw materials can be added into a liquid inlet 13 on the side wall of each liquid storage tank 15, the first motor 12 rotates to drive the first motor shaft 14 to rotate, so that the stirring rope 16 can rapidly rotate and stir in the liquid storage tanks 15, the stirred initial raw materials flow into the next stirring tank 10 through the liquid outlet 4, the second motor 18 rotates to drive the second motor shaft 21 to rotate, the stirring column 20 fixedly connected with the second motor shaft 21 also starts to rotate and stir various raw materials in the stirring tank 10 to be uniformly stirred, finally, a drainage tube 24 arranged below the stirring tank 10 flows out a final finished product, an injection port 23 can jet out thinner liquid to facilitate receiving, after all liquid is emptied from the stirring tank 10, clean water is injected from the water inlet 6, and the stirring and cleaning of the stirring tank 10 are performed by the stirring of the second motor 18, after the cleaning is finished, a water outlet 9 is arranged for discharging dirty water after the cleaning.
